Lemon Cookies
The Ingredients
1 cup flour
1/4 cup sifted powdered sugar
2 tsp lemon zest
1 stick unsalted butter, softened
1/4 tsp vanilla extract
2-3 drops lemon oil
1 cup (more) sifted powdered sugar
The Method
Lower oven rack to 2/3 down and pre-heat to 350 degrees F.
Mix flour, sugar, and zest in medium bowl with spoon (no need to mess up mixer). Add vanilla, lemon oil and softened butter and stir until dough is consistent.
Roll dough into small balls and flatten slightly onto cookie sheets lined with parchment paper.
Bake 14 minutes or until bottoms are golden brown. Cool completely on wire rack.
Once cookies are completely cool, gently place them in a gallon zip-lock bag with about 1 cup of sifted powdered sugar and move them around till they are covered. Store in this bag or any other air-tight container.
